【技术实现步骤摘要】
电子订单推送方法及系统、服务器及存储介质
本专利技术涉及订单推送技术,尤其是涉及一种电子订单推送方法及系统、服务器及存储介质。
技术介绍
目前,外卖订单一般多采用抢单的方式,其虽然提高了快递员的积极性,但是也导致快递员都争抢一些配送距离近的订单,而抢到这些订单的快递员可能正在送餐途中或者正在等待上一订单的配货,从而导致其抢到的订单的送货时间无法保障,而且经常出现快递员骑车或开车送货的同时通过手机抢单的状态,其也不利于快递员的安全性。
技术实现思路
本专利技术的目的在于克服上述技术不足,提出一种电子订单推送方法及系统、服务器及存储介质,解决现有技术中送货时间无法保障及影响快递员的安全性的技术问题。为达到上述技术目的,本专利技术的技术方案第一方面提供一种电子订单推送方法,包括如下步骤:获取客户的待配送外卖订单及所述待配送外卖订单的配货位置和送货位置;获取每一个快递员的实时位置及其当前配送订单,预测其当前配送订单的完成时间,并判断每一个快递员的当前配送订单的送货位置和完成时间与待配送外卖 ...
【技术保护点】
1.一种电子订单推送方法,其特征在于,包括如下步骤:/nS1、获取客户的待配送外卖订单及所述待配送外卖订单的配货位置和送货位置;/nS2、获取每一个快递员的实时位置及其当前配送订单,预测其当前配送订单的完成时间,并判断每一个快递员的当前配送订单的送货位置和完成时间与待配送外卖订单的配货位置是否满足设定要求;/nS3、对满足设定要求的所有快递员进行排序,并将待配送外卖订单推送给排序首位的快递员;/n其中,所述设定要求至少包括:/n
【技术特征摘要】
1.一种电子订单推送方法,其特征在于,包括如下步骤:
S1、获取客户的待配送外卖订单及所述待配送外卖订单的配货位置和送货位置;
S2、获取每一个快递员的实时位置及其当前配送订单,预测其当前配送订单的完成时间,并判断每一个快递员的当前配送订单的送货位置和完成时间与待配送外卖订单的配货位置是否满足设定要求;
S3、对满足设定要求的所有快递员进行排序,并将待配送外卖订单推送给排序首位的快递员;
其中,所述设定要求至少包括:
为第个快递员的当前配送订单的送货位置与待配送外卖订单的配货位置之间的距离,为一设定常数,为正整数,为第个快递员当前配送订单的完成时间,为第个待配送外卖订单的订单提交时间,为一设定常数,为正整数,为第个快递员到达第个待配送外卖订单的配货位置的预测到达时间,为第个待配送外卖订单的配货时间,为一设定常数,为预设的快递员行进速度,为第个快递员的调整参数。
2.根据权利要求1所述的电子订单推送方法,其特征在于,获取每一个快递员的实时位置及其当前配送订单具体包括:
获取该待配送外卖订单的配货位置附近设定范围内的每一个快递员的实时位置及其当前配送订单。
3.根据权利要求1所述的电子订单推送方法,其特征在于,步骤S1还包括获取待配送外卖订单的配货时间,若配货时间大于设定阈值,则延迟执行步骤S2和S3。
4.根据权利要求3所述的电子订单推送方法,其特征在于,所述延迟执行步骤S2和S3的延迟时间与所述待配送外卖订单的配货时间相同。
5.根据权利要求4所述的电子订单推送方法,其特征在于,所述电子订单推送方法还包括获取每一个快递员到达其待配送外卖订单的配货位置的实际到达时间,并根据实际到达时间对预测到达时间中的调整参数进行训练。
6.根...
【专利技术属性】
技术研发人员:王涛,
申请(专利权)人:北京每日优鲜电子商务有限公司,
类型:发明
国别省市:北京;11
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。